Feeling discouraged by trying soft foods. eggs and tuna, were my go-to but every time I eat them I have to lay down for 30 minutes. I don’t enjoy cottage cheese, but enjoy yogurt and some fruits... but none of this is Protein.

So I’m going back to my blender... this is still my first 4 days of soft foods but I’m feeling discouraged. I’m sipping a homemade smoothie currently and feeling much better. Any other ideas?

Like many other people here, eggs were really hard for me, no matter how I did them. Still not great, to be honest. tuna was tough too - it is a bit dry. It gets easier but don’t stress - there are options.

Yoghurt is Protein, and there are high-protein yoghurts available too.

Cottage cheese is worth persevering with. I don’t care for it but it is delicious savoury - add chipotle, or Sriracha, or a bit of chilli flakes. Or have it sweet - add mushed banana, apple sauce, pineapple purée, berries (strained). I really got to love my different flavours of cottage cheese in soft food stage!

Steam a bit of fresh fish and mush it. Much easier than tuna from a pouch. My surgeon had me eating that from day 2.

Hummus. Feta whip. Mashed edamame Beans with a bit of mayo - yum. All high protein...

Remember: This stage, too, shall pass...

I started buying tuna creations flavored and add tsp. of dressing to add a little extra creaminess. cottage cheese, has been my saviour, but regular cottage cheese provides the most comforting sensation. Try ricotta add seasonings.
BP store and Amazon have some great tasting Protein puddings. WonderSlim chocolate caramel... great as a shake or pudding.
have you tried pureed chili? one of these posts has my recipe for Hungarian zucchini stew and would add unflavored Protein Powder. super soft, but can also be pureed. cheese sticks, and deli turkey roll ups. high protein and soft
